Alxamdulilaay (Thanks be to God) A common expression here. You can practically add it to any sentence in Wolof. That and inchallah (God willing). But here are some pictures of my school where I take classes 4 days a week and my new neighborhood Sacre Coeur 3 which is about a 15 min walk away.

The common and cheapest mode of transportation: Carrapide

You just jump on whenever you see one, pay 20 cents, and tap a
coin on the side of the car when you want to get off. The trouble
is knowing where it is  headed. There is an apprenti hanging off of
the back who can tell you.

another mode of transportation. horse carts just mesh right in
with the carrapides and buses and cars and taxis.
